  • Patent number: 5717051
    Abstract: A glass composite material comprising a polymer chain selected from the group consisting of polysilane, polygermane, polystannane and a copolymer thereof, and a network structure of a metal oxide consisting of a metal atom bonded to the other metal atom through an oxygen atom, wherein the polymer chain is chemically crosslinked with a glass matrix of the network structure of the metal oxide directly or indirectly, and a volume resistivity measured by setting a ratio of a voltage to a film thickness at 10.sup.6 V/cm according to a disc plate electrode method is not more than 3.times.10.sup.6 .OMEGA.cm.
    Type: Grant
    Filed: September 19, 1995
    Date of Patent: February 10, 1998
    Assignee: Kabushiki Kaisha Toshiba
    Inventors: Toshiro Hiraoka, Yutaka Majima, Kenji Todori, Julian R. Koe, Yoshihiko Nakano, Shinji Murai, Shuzi Hayase

  • Patent number: 5530956
    Abstract: A non-linear optical device is disclosed, which comprises an optical waveguide complex wherein a part of the waveguide complex is formed of a non-linear element containing a polysilane having an average weight of 5,000 to 1,000,000 and having a repeating unit represented by formula ##STR1## Where R.sup.1 and R.sup.2 are independently selected from the group consisting of a hydrogen atom, a substituted or unsubstituted alkyl group, a substituted or unsubstituted aryl group, and a substituted or unsubstituted aralkyl group, and particles having a particle size of 10 to 500 .ANG. selected from the group consisting of conductors, semiconductors, and mixture thereof.
    Type: Grant
    Filed: May 26, 1995
    Date of Patent: June 25, 1996
    Assignee: Kabushiki Kaisha Toshiba
    Inventors: Toshiro Hiraoka, Shin-ichi Nakamura, Yoshihiko Nakano, Shinji Murai, Shuzi Hayase
